WC 2018: Real Madrid ace Bale stars as Wales romp Moldova

Gareth Bale was the star of the show as Wales opened their 2018 World Cup Group D qualifying campaign in style against Moldova.

Chris Coleman's Dragons scored a 4-0 victory in Cardiff with two goals either side of half-time, finished off by a Bale brace.

Burnley striker Sam Vokes gave Wales the lead when he leapt above his marker to head home a delightful Bale cross in the 38th minute.

The home side's lead was soon doubled when Moldova keeper Ilie Cebanu did not do enough to clear Joe Ledley's corner with the ball falling for Stoke City recruit Joe Allen who fired home a first-time effort for his first international goal.

Five minutes into the second half and the Welsh were 3-0 when Real Madrid superstar Bale receive an absolute gift of a backpass from Ion Jardan before advancing into the area and deftly chipping beyond Cebanu.

And it was all wrapped up in injury time when Bale was pulled down in the area and stepped up to successfully convert form 12 yards for his 24th goal for his country.
